Comparison of N-glycan structures derived from adult Wt AB and mgat1b?/? mutant zebrafish. Averaged MS spectra of released N-glycan types (%) from Wt AB (purple bars) and mgat1b?/? (gold bars) zebrafish (A). Representative bar graphs showing the percents of oligomannose (B), hybrid (C), and complex (D) structures with the corresponding m/z value of the structures. Data are presented as mean ± SEM, n = 4, where n signifies the number of technical replicates, and Wt AB to mutant zebrafish were compared using Student?s t-test (* p < 0.11, * p < 0.08, ** p < 0.05, *** p < 0.01). |
